Transaction ffdf72babc2b5c08e66cb3c5a3556573fbbaa866fc33fd20a28d09fe1eb4a852
1 Input
2 Outputs
- ffdf72babc2b5c08e66cb3c5a3556573fbbaa866fc33fd20a28d09fe1eb4a852:0
- ffdf72babc2b5c08e66cb3c5a3556573fbbaa866fc33fd20a28d09fe1eb4a852:1
value 27746
address 39gn7Sx8ZfwBUEoD8KoMt449bb6UiUbT8y
value 74087
address 1Aich3LRuqBAG1wuaq9eGbbW8BFQwTgsrX